Job Description

Description

Essential Job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Learn new software programs and train division personnel.
  • Develop training aids and quick reference guides for users.
  • Install personal computer and printer for new employees.
  • Provide training to new employees on the computer system and hardware packages.
  • Schedule and coordinate Skillware or other offsite training for new employees.
  • Provide ongoing training support to division personnel.
  • Update division personnel concerning changes in computer procedures.
  • Serve as division office microcomputer system administrator by maintaining division distribution lists passwords and library of standard documents.
  • Install computer hardware and software upgrades.
  • Assist field staff personnel with agent training on software packages such as Open Crisp by preparing training materials and/or making training presentations.
  • Accompany field personnel to install computer hardware/software in agents office.
  • Provide assistance with telephone calls from field staff and agents to resolve problems using computer software and hardware.
  • Division liaison with Information Technology department to identify and resolve division problems with computer communication network hardware or software.
  • Perform other jobrelated duties as necessary.
